ANDOVER, MA — Raytheon Technologies Corp., which has locations in Andover and Waltham, announced Wednesday it plans to cut 15,000 jobs in the aerospace industry due to fallout from the coronavirus pandemic. At a Morgan Stanley conference, Raytheon CEO Greg Hayes announced the cuts as part of efforts to reduce $2 billion in …Raytheon Technologies Corp. will lay off 15,000 employees in its commercial aerospace and corporate divisions, as the multinational defense and commercial aerospace conglomerate seeks $2 billion ...

On a firm fixed price contract you have a set contract value, call it $1M. At the end of the day you'll have $1M of revenue/sales regardless of spending $5 or $5M. Cutting costs will change when you incur the revenue but depending on the factors it could be left or right.RMD gets sales by having people charge contracts so when you see sales are below expectations it's partially due to not being able to hire enough people. This is also why OT is generally welcomed by management, if they have 20 people working 10% OT it's like they have 22 people charging contracts and driving sales.
